Hungarian drummer and producer Oliver Zisko returns with his most ambitious and heaviest solo effort to date. Titled PLAN(e)T-based, the upcoming album is set for vinyl and digital release on June 1, 2026, blending crushing modern metal textures with sophisticated fusion-prog craftsmanship.
After tracking drums for countless metal albums in recent years, Zisko channels that accumulated intensity into a concept that pushes far beyond traditional instrumental territory.
Heavier Vision, Progressive Core
The sonic identity of PLAN(e)T-based is defined by:
Crushing 8-string (and occasionally down-tuned) guitar tones
Complex, groove-driven rhythmic structures
Fusion-inspired harmonic depth
Progressive arrangements within a modern metal framework
The result is a technically refined yet emotionally charged instrumental record that navigates the intersection of progressive metal and jazz-fusion.
Zisko not only performs drums, but also handles keyboards, programming, mixing, and mastering, maintaining full artistic control over the final sound.
International All-Star Line-Up
One of the album’s strongest assets is its remarkable line-up, featuring musicians associated with some of progressive music’s most respected names.
Keyboards
Derek Sherinian (ex-Dream Theater, Planet X) – special guest solo on the track “Connection”
Bass
Anthony Crawford (Allan Holdsworth band, Witherfall)
Robin Zielhorst (ex-Cynic, Exivious, currently in Obscura)
Peter Erdei (ex-Kurt Rosenwinkel band)
Roland Racz
Peter Papesch
Guitars
Márton Kertész (Special Providence, Sear Bliss, Rivers Ablaze)
Marius Pop (Smiley)
Attila Kovács (Bong-Ra, The Answer Lies in the Black Void, Superbutt)
With contributors spanning the worlds of prog metal, fusion, technical death metal, and experimental music, PLAN(e)T-based positions itself as a truly cross-genre endeavor.
